Situated on the outskirts
of Copenhagen -the capital of Denmark- the Siemens Arena
in BALLERUP is easy to reach.
By plane:
Flights to the airport of Copenhagen-Kastrup
(CPH) with all major international airlines.
Taxi from the airport to Ballerup
approx. 350-400 Danish Kroner (= roundabout 45-55 € / US$)
By car:
From Skandinavia:
via Malmö or Helsingborg, follow
the E 47/E 55 direction south, exit at exit 23 (Jyllinge Vej), keep the
road direction Ballerup (in turns into a motorway) and leave this motorway
at exit Ballerup C, turn right onto the Ballerup Boulevard and you will
see the hall on your right. Turn in at the next possibility on your right.
From Central Europe:
In Germany take the highway A1,
A7 or A24 direction Hamburg.
From Hamburg you have the choice:
1)
to go all the way by road (continue
on the A7 direction Flensburg, Roskilde, Købnhavn) over the new
bridge (toll= 30 € one way, + roundabout 200 km longer
way) to Denmark.
2)
to insert a relaxing 1 hour ferry
trip from Puttgarden to Rødby Havn (proposed). For
this continue from Hamburg on the A1 direction Lübeck / Puttgarden
/ Rødby until you hit the Ferry-harbour in Puttgarden. Ferries
go regularly every 30 minutes or so (price per car incl. 5 Pers.: roundabout
95€/US$).
In Denmark follow the E47/E55 direction
Købnhavn. After exit 27 change over to motorway 21 (ring IV). Continue
on this motorway direction Ballerup. Leave this motorway at exit Ballerup
C, turn right onto the Ballerup Boulevard and you will see the hall on
your right. Turn in at the next possibility on your right. |
